In a world that demands constant external validation and performative joy, laulaja-lauluntekija offers a sanctuary of genuine interiority. The friction arises from the genre's insistence on personal truth and vulnerability against the market's pull towards easily digestible, universalized sentiment. It champions the specific, the local, the often-unspoken anxieties and joys of the individual, resisting the homogenization of identity. Here, the self is not a brand to be optimized, but a complex, fragile narrative to be told, understood in its quiet, often melancholic, authenticity.
Acoustic guitars often strum with a gentle, persistent rhythm, or fingerpick intricate, melancholic patterns that feel like quiet conversations. Piano chords resonate with a certain gravitas, providing a harmonic bedrock for the often-poetic lyrics. The voice, central and unvarnished, delivers narratives with a sincerity that feels both vulnerable and resilient. These sounds do not demand attention; they invite contemplation, building an intimate world where every note and word carries weight, refusing the ephemeral for the enduring.
Rhythm
Generally unhurried, acoustic-driven, serving as a gentle pulse for the lyrical unfolding.
Texture
Predominantly acoustic guitars, pianos, and sometimes subtle strings or woodwinds, creating an intimate, organic warmth.
Melody
Accessible and memorable, frequently steeped in minor keys, evoking a sense of wistfulness or quiet beauty.
Voice
Clear, often unadorned, conveying sincerity and direct personal narrative.
Humor
Often a wry, understated observation of life's absurdities or a subtle self-deprecation.
